Comparing Gastric Botox with Other Weight Loss Procedures



Comparing gastric Botox with other weight loss procedures involves evaluating the efficacy, safety, mechanisms, and overall outcomes of different interventions aimed at addressing obesity.

Botox injections in the stomach lining target appetite suppression by delaying gastric emptying and promoting a sense of fullness. It's a minimally invasive procedure performed endoscopically, making it appealing to individuals seeking non-surgical weight loss options. However, its effects may be temporary, necessitating repeated injections for sustained results.

In contrast, bariatric surgeries like gastric bypass or sleeve gastrectomy alter the anatomy of the digestive system, restricting food intake and influencing nutrient absorption. These surgeries offer substantial weight loss and potential resolution of obesity-related comorbidities but involve more significant surgical risks and lifestyle changes.

Non-invasive treatments such as gastric balloons involve placing an inflatable device in the stomach, reducing its capacity and promoting feelings of fullness. While temporary and reversible, they may cause discomfort and have limited long-term efficacy.

Pharmacological interventions, like weight loss medications, target appetite control, fat absorption, or metabolism regulation. They offer a non-invasive approach but might have side effects and varying efficacy among individuals.
